Urban fuel economy of fossil fuel powered road vehicles is about 30% less than extra urban fuel economy due to urban traffic congestion and poor air quality.

XECON Optimiser energises urban air quality to boost urban fuel economy.

By preprocessing engine blow-by gases, XECON Optimiser improves engine efficiency by reducing detonation (gas/petrol engine) and pre-ignition (gas/petrol & diesel engines) of current high compression internal compression engines.

XECON Optimiser has been real world tested over 10 years in about 15,000 road vehicles of various makes, models, age and fuelled by petrol, diesel, liquid petroleum gas and compressed natural gas in 12 countries: UK; Germany; Poland; Netherlands; India; China; Malaysia; Singapore; New Zealand; Australia; Jamaica and Papua New Guinea to test its suitability in different weather, terrains, road conditions as well as different fossil fuel types and grades.
